Hi,
What does the widescreen pull down menu in the preferences window do? Donald

The widescreen version of the Marine Aquarium allows you to have 8 fish instead of 7. The "widescreen" fish chosen from the pop-up menu will only come into play when you've got a 16:9 widescreen Aquarium on your screen. In addition to the extra fish, you will also note that the widescreen version has some extra (purple) coral, the bubble column on the right instead of left, and a completely different (older) version of light reflections on the coral and sand.
